A refractory mix for forming an in situ magnesium aluminate spinel brick consisting essentially of about 65 to 95 wt.% magnesite having an MgO content of at least about 92 wt.% and, correspondingly, about 35 to 1 wt.% calcined bauxite having an alumina content of at least about 83 wt.% and a silica content of no more than about 7 wt.%; the total silica content of the mix being no more than about 4 wt.% and a magnesium aluminate spinel refractory shape prepared by pressing and firing the the above refractory mixture. The invention also comprises the process of forming the refractory.
